Board approves expanded-learning plan, partners with Boys & Girls Club and buys vehicles for childcare program
Summary
The Ocean View School District approved an updated ELOP implementation guide, new vehicles funded by ELOP, and a one‑year $3.6M (not-to-exceed) contractor agreement with the Boys & Girls Club of Huntington Valley to deliver after-school and summer childcare while the district builds staffing capacity.
The Ocean View School District Board of Trustees approved the district’s revamped Expanded Learning and Child Care (ELOP) implementation guide and a set of operational actions intended to expand access to free childcare for TK–6 students.
